System and methodology for parallel query optimization using semantic-based partitioning

A system and methodology for parallel query optimization using semantic-based partitioning is described. In one embodiment, for example, in a database system comprising a database storing data in database tables, a method is described for improving query performance by dynamically partitioning the data, the method comprises steps of: receiving a query requesting data from the database; generating a plurality of subplans for executing the query, each subplan including one or more operators for performing relational operations; adding operators for partitioning data and performing a given relational operation in parallel to at least some of the plurality of subplans; and building a plan for execution of the query based, at least in part, upon selecting subplans having favorable execution costs.
